Game Summary

On Thursday, February 19, 2026, the No. 7 seeded Copper Hills Grizzlies faced the No. 10 seeded Farmington Phoenix in a 6A state playoff second-round matchup. Copper Hills established an early lead and maintained control throughout the contest, ultimately outlasting Farmington with a final score of 41-30. The victory secured their advancement in the Utah high school girls basketball state championships.

Advancement in the 6A Bracket

With this victory, Copper Hills progressed to the quarterfinals of the Utah High School Activities Association (UHSAA) 6A Girls Basketball State Championships. The quarterfinal, semifinal, and final rounds of the 6A tournament are typically held at the Jon M. Huntsman Center on the campus of the University of Utah in Salt Lake City.

Overview of the 6A State Playoffs

The 6A state playoffs feature teams from across Utah competing in a single-elimination bracket format. Early rounds, including the second round where this game was played, are often hosted at the home sites of the higher-seeded teams.
